2018-07-10链上侧链

区块链网络速度慢是目前最大的痛点,侧链作为区块链的扩容孕育而生。

侧链

侧链是相对于主链的,最早是2014年由比特币的核心开发团队提出的,为了实现比特币和其他数字资产在多个区块链间的转移,简单的说,侧链就是一种使货币在两条区块链间移动的机制。

现实生活中,各个银行相当于不同的主链,而第三方支付公司(支付宝或者微信)就相当于侧链。

主链缺乏的功能,侧链来提供。

通过侧链可以在主链的基础上,进行交易隐私保护技术、智能合约等新功能的添加,这样可以让用户访问大量的新型服务,并且对现有主链的工作并不造成影响。另外,侧链也提供了一种更安全的协议升级方式,当侧链发生灾难性的问题时,主链依然安然无恙。

三种组合应用

(1)主链和侧链都是中心化的。

(2)主链是去中心化,侧链是中心化的

(3)主链是去中心化,侧链也是去中心化


运行原理

以小微支付为例:

A和B有频繁小额支付阶段的需求,这时首先在主链上锁定一笔金额,然后侧链进行A和B的支付,一段时间后A和B通过主链进行结算并进行token金额的划拨。在整个过程,主链作为结算层,侧链作为支付层。侧链,作为A和B之间交易支付的记账者,记录了每一笔的交易,而主链只做一段时间内的结果记账;从而提高了交易效率与速度。

利用侧链可以支持各种智能化的应用,比如说小微支付、股票、期货交易等。

目前侧链技术

(1)闪电网络/雷电网络

(2)BTC-Relay

(3)RootStock

(4)Elements(元素链)

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容